Canon India on an expansion mode

By Nabamita Chatterjee | Vjmedia Works | March 08, 2017

Canon envisions opening a total of 300 stores by 2018

 With over 200 Canon Image Square (CIS) stores in India, CIS sales closes up to 1/3rd of the total sales for Canon India as informed by them. Canon India forayed into the retail space in 2010. As part of its completion of 20 years in India they are targeting tier 2 and tier 3 markets as part of its robust expansion plans. Canon envisions opening a total of 300 stores by 2018. CIS stores have a comprehensive range of photography and home printing solutions along with a range of Inkjet/Laser printers and cartridges and other photography accessories on offer, the CIS stores consolidates Canon’s position in the imaging industry.


Also, they are organizing a pan India roadshow across 60 cities to strengthen customer connect across the country. Designed from an interactive consumer engagement perspective, providing hands on experience of Canon products to potential customers, the roadshow is all set to be executed in approximately 60 cities, reaching out to end customer in Tier 3 / 4 cities, throughout the year 2017. Canon booth in the roadshow will provide experience zone with Click & Print activity for potential customers with range of cameras and printer on display. The month of March will witness roadshows in cities like Gurgaon, Meerut, Jodhpur, Jamshedpur, Patna and Varanasi.
